Proverbs 6:1-5 NLT
[1] My child, if you have put up security for a friend's debt or agreed to guarantee the debt of a stranger - if you have trapped yourself by your agreement and are caught by what you said - follow my advice and save yourself, for you have placed yourself at your friend's mercy.
Now swallow your pride; go and beg to have your name erased.
Don't put it off;
do it now!
Don't rest until you do. Save yourself like a gazelle escaping from a hunter, like a bird fleeing from a net.
Proverbs 6:1-5 NLT
If only Herod had been able to follow the advice of this Proverb!
We've got it wrong, made a mistake, don't put it off...don't let pride get in the way...step towards the problem and own it.
I wonder how many times in my life things would have been so much better if I had followed this Proverb...my pride, my fear of looking like I've made a mistake, got it wrong, what others will think of me, embarrassment...it's so easy for those things to be the loudest voice in my head.
How loud a thought is, is not a measure of it's worth or it's truth.
Where do we need to take our thoughts captive today?
Where do we need to sidestep pride?
